(a) DECLARATION.—I, J. M. Ollivier, of Balmoral, Amuri, do hereby solemnly declare that the Sheep, 420 in number, marked L, now being depastured by me at the North Bank of the Hurunui, have not within three months last past had applied to any of them any reputed scab-destroying preparation, nor been mixed with any Sheep infected with scab or catarrh; and I make this solemn declaration, conscientiously believing the same to be true.

J. M. OLLIVIER.

Declared before me at Hastie’s, this 4th day of November, 1864.—H. RAMSAY SCARVELL, Inspector of Sheep.

(b) DECLARATION.—I, William Dunford, sen., of Lavington Station, do hereby solemnly declare that I have made a complete muster of all the Sheep in my charge, and that my Sheep, branded —, being 8,000 in number, now being at Lavington, have not within two months last past had applied to any of them any reputed scab-destroying preparation, nor within two months been mixed with any Sheep infected with scab or catarrh; and I make this solemn declaration, conscientiously believing the same to be true.

WILLIAM DUNFORD, senior.

Declared before me at Lavington, this 12th day of November, 1864.—P. B. BOULTON, Inspector of Sheep.

(c) DECLARATION.—I, John Studholme, of Waimate, do hereby solemnly declare that the Sheep, three in number, marked —, now being depastured by me at the Waitaki River, Province of Otago, have not within three months last past had applied to any of them any reputed scab-destroying preparation, nor within three months been mixed with any Sheep infected with scab or catarrh; and I make this solemn declaration, conscientiously believing the same to be true.

JOHN STUDHOLME.

Declared before me at Waimate, this 24th day of November, 1864.—ANDREW PATERSON, Inspector of Sheep.
